About Winskill Elementary

Winskill Elementary is a public elementary school in Lancaster, WI, part of Lancaster Community School District. Winskill Elementary serves approximately 456 students, and covers grades Pre-K-5th, and has a 12.3:1 student-teacher ratio. Winskill Elementary has a current MySchoolScout rating of 9.3 out of 10 and ranks #35 of 2,105 schools in WI.

Structured state assessment records for Winskill Elementary show 56%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 50%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).

What Parents Should Know

Winskill Elementary s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.
